The rugby podcast allergic to hot takes. Sam Roberts and Sam Larner guide you through the World of rugby, picking out the big stories, controversial topics, and exciting developments of the game we all love. In the companion Blindside podcast, you'll hear interviews with big, and not so big, names from around the game, plus Q&As with the Sams, and conversations with fans both of pro teams and dedicated followers of grassroots rugby. Sam Roberts is a rugby commentator with too many years of experience to list. You will have heard him on the Rugby Inheritance Podcast with Ed Slater as well as on countless broadcasts. Sam Larner is an analyst and journalist with a passion for numbers. You can read his work in Rugby World and on Rugby Pass and he's never too far from guesting on someone else's podcast.
